一、安装mysql数据源驱动
1. 如果找不到mysqi数据源,需要安装myodbc,安装myodbc之后,需要在控制面板里进行配置mysql的数据源。
在控制面板里找到管理工具,双击,进去后双击数据源 (ODBC)
点击添加按钮在弹出的对话框中找到安装的myodbc驱动并点击完成按钮,进行如下配置
点击Test按钮,如果弹出下面的对话框,表示配置正确
点击OK按钮,mysql的数据源配置完成。
二、利用sqlserver2000将mysql数据库中的数据迁移到oracle数据库中。
1.在开始菜单找到sqlserver2000,在下来菜单里找到导入和导出数据。
2.点击下一步按钮,进行设置。
3.在数据源选项中找到mysqldb,如果没有选择其他(ODBC数据源)
在用户/系统DSN的选项中选择mysqldb,如果没有,点击新建按钮,选择文件数据源
4.选择文件数据源,下一步。
5.选择myodbc,下一步
6.输入你的mysql数据源的名字mysqldb,下一步
7.配置完成会跳转到下面的界面进行配置源数据库,用户/系统DSN选择mysqldb,输入用户名和密码,点击下一步。
8.选择目的数据库,选择oracle Provider for OLE DB,点击属性按钮。
9.配置目标数据库oracle,数据源处需要填写tnsname中设置的背地NET服务名,输入用户名和密码,点击测试连接按钮进行测试。
10.如果配置正确会弹出测试成功的对话框。
11.点击确定按钮。
12.点击下一步。
13.选择从源数据库复制表和视图,下一步。
14.选择需要迁移到oracle数据库中的表,下一步。
15.选择立即运行,下一步。
16.点击完成按钮。
17.如果成功导入,会返回下面的对话框。
三、导入报错处理,很可能导入的时候会提示错误,我遇到的错误主要是建表错误和导入错误。
1.建表错误
2.双击错误可以得到详细的提示。
分享到:
相关推荐
SQL Server 2000 DTS Step by Step part 002
Microsoft SQL Server 2000 Data Transformation Services (DTS) 包设计器是一种设计工具,在以 SQL Server 2005 Integration Services 包格式升级或重新创建 DTS 包之前,SQL Server 2005 服务器的开发人员和管理员...
sql-server数据转换服务(DTS)(sql到oracle)详细图解.pdf
sql server 2000完全实战——数据转换报务(dts)
详细介绍了从SQL Server迁移大批量数据到Oracle的方法和具体的操作步骤。
SQLServer2005 DTS 补丁(For SQL Server 2000 DTS)
这意味着不仅可以在SQL Server 数据源间进行数据的转储,而且可以把Sybase, Oracle, Informix 下的数据传递到SQL Server。利用Data Transformation Services (DTS) 可能在任何OLE DB、 ODBC 驱动程序的数据源或...
利用SQL Server DTS工具实现异类数据源转换.pdf
delphi调用sql server 中DTS导入数据,纯delphi代码;需要安装sqlserver dts;支持txt\access\sqlserver\xls 之间的批量导入处理,事务保护,保证数据完整性,效率高
利用SQLServer的DTS操作EXCEL、Access等数据表的导入导出.pdf
利用DTS导入_导出向导实现SQL Server数据库表的数据转换.pdf
SQLSERVER中利用dts将oracle数据库导入到SQLSERVER.pdf
通过SQLServer的DTS工具,可以将ORACLE表中的数据导出到EXCLE ,也可以将EXCEL中数据导入到ORACELE
sqlserver-dts简介,sqlserver-dts简介
下载foo_input_dts,并解压,复制foo_input_dts.dll到foobar2000安装路径下components 文件夹下,然后打开foobar2000中文版文件选参数选项,选取DSP管理器,在最右边可使用DSP里选择DTS DECODER 添加到已激活的选...
本文将介绍使用DTS向导和Transact-SQL语句来实现SQL Server、ACCESS和EXCEL之间的数据转换。 一、使用DTS向导实现数据转换 DTS(Data Transformation Services)是SQL Server提供的一种数据导入导出工具,它可以将...
探究SQL Server的数据转换服务(DTS).pdf